The Department of Defense (DOD) implemented the Advanced Concept Technology Demonstration (ACTD) process in 1994 as an alternative to the more traditional, overly bureaucratic acquisition system in place throughout the 1970s and 1980s. Many senior leaders in the Office of the Secretary of Defense (OSD) and the services heralded the process as an important component of DOD's acquisition reform revolution.
